    [01] President Clerides - Kranidiotis - Tributes

    Nicosia, Sep 15 (CNA) -- Tributes poured in today from everybody for Cypriot born Alternate Foreign Minister of Greece, killed late last night when his plane plunged from a high altitude as it was coming in to land, praising Yiannos Kranidiotis the man and Kranioditis the politician as "a special friend and an excellent diplomat."

    President Glafcos Clerides said his death was "a national tragedy" at a crucial time for Cyprus and pointed out that his passing away left "a void because he knew the Cyprus question very well and as a Cypriot he had a special interest in Cyprus."

    [02] Kranidiotis - Political parties - Condolences

    Nicosia, Sep 15 (CNA) -- Political parties here have expressed "shock and deep sorrow" for the untimely death of Greece's Alternate Foreign Minister, Cypriot born Yiannos Kranidiotis and paid tribute to his contribution to Cyprus.

    Kranidiotis and five other people, including his 23-year-old son, were killed when the aircraft they were travelling in to Romania plunged from a high altitude before landing at Bucharest airport.

    [03] Kranidiotis - Cyprus

    Nicosia, Sep 15 (CNA) -- Cyprus has declared a three-day mourning period with flags flying at half mast to mourn the death of Yiannos Kranidiotis, killed with another five persons in a plane which suddenly lost altitude before landing at Bucharest airport.

    Announcing the decision after a meeting with the Foreign Minister and the Government Spokesman, Acting President and House President Spyros Kyprianou said "President Clerides, the government, the House, the political leadership and the people of Cyprus feel great pain and a big loss."
